How Does It Work
Skin tag removal at Beauty Advance is performed using thermolysis, a precise cauterisation technique that applies a controlled electrical current to the base of the tag. This destroys the tissue at the point of attachment, allowing the tag to be removed immediately while leaving the surrounding skin largely undisturbed.
The method is accurate enough to treat skin tags in delicate locations, including close to the eyes and between the eyelashes. No cutting or stitching is involved, and the treatment is completed in seconds per tag. In cases where a lesion could be a benign mole rather than a skin tag, a GP letter may be required before treatment begins.

What Are Skin Tags?
Skin tags are small, soft growths made up of loose collagen fibres and tiny blood vessels enclosed in skin. They are completely benign and not contagious. Most are skin-coloured, range in size from a few millimetres to around 5cm, and tend to hang off the skin rather than sit flat against it, which is one of the key ways to distinguish them from warts or moles.
They develop most commonly on the neck, underarms, groin, under the breasts, on the eyelids, and within skin folds. Although harmless, they can grow larger over time and are often removed because they snag on clothing, cause irritation, or affect confidence.

Is skin tag removal painful?
Most clients find the procedure very manageable. The thermolysis technique delivers a brief, controlled sensation at the point of treatment, which passes within seconds. For tags in more sensitive areas, such as the eyelids, your practitioner will take additional care and talk you through the process before beginning. Any post-treatment tenderness is mild and typically settles within a day or two.
Will skin tag removal leave a scar?
In most cases, thermolysis leaves minimal marking once the skin has fully healed. Small scabs form as part of the natural healing process and usually resolve within a few days to two weeks. There is a small risk of temporary pigmentation changes or minor scarring, which your practitioner will discuss with you during your consultation. Following the aftercare instructions provided reduces this risk significantly.

Skin tag removal is a quick, clinician-led treatment designed to safely remove small, harmless growths that can become uncomfortable, catch on clothing or affect confidence.
Skin tags are made up of loose collagen fibres and small blood vessels surrounded by skin. Collagen is a natural protein found throughout the body. Skin tags are usually soft, skin-coloured growths and can vary in size from just a few millimetres up to around 5cm.
They are most commonly found on the neck, under the arms, around the groin, under the breasts, on the eyelids and within skin folds, including under the buttocks.
Skin tags can sometimes be mistaken for warts, but they are usually smooth and soft, tend to hang off the skin rather than sit flat, and are not contagious. Although harmless, they can grow larger over time if left untreated.
